Australia's Sky News has placed its 7th order for the LU60 HD backpack.

Sky News, the most renowned multi-platform news provider in Australia and New Zealand, has placed its seventh order for LiveU's flagship product, the LU-60 series 3G news live broadcasting system. As a highlight of this latest collaboration, Sky News has adopted LiveU's latest antenna array technology, which utilizes a new approach for real-time transmission, representing a revolutionary advancement beyond traditional modem-based transmission. Recently, LiveU has also completed the integration of the Telstra 4G modem, enabling news coverage in areas where signal was previously poor or where 3G transmission was virtually impossible.
LiveU's flagship product, the LU-60, features new software that allows for multiple wireless connections, supporting up to 14 SIM cards (3G/4G). These can be unified to provide a stable, broadcast-quality uplink video signal, effectively packing a high-definition satellite truck into a backpack. Additionally, support for 1080i HD resolution and ultra-low latency of less than 1 second are new features of the LU-60.
